2024 Buckingham County Photo Contest

There were over 30 entries in the 2024 Buckingham Photo Contest. The Grand Prize was $75, 1st place in each category received $30, 2nd places received $20 and 3rd places received $10. All winners received ribbons. The 2024 categories were: Buckingham County Events; Farm Animals & Pets; Wildlife (Animals, Birds, Insects); Nature; Historic and Vintage, plus Youth Entries. Entries in the 2025 contest will be accepted from April 1st to July 15th. The photos must be taken (preferably digital so they can be professionally published) in Buckingham County and both the Buckingham Chamber and Buckingham County must be given permission  to use them.
